What Are License Bonds?

A license bond is a type of surety bond that protects the public or a government agency when a business or professional fails to comply with applicable licensing rules. Unlike traditional insurance, a surety bond involves an agreement between the principal, obligee, and surety company.

The specific requirements, bond amount, and conditions can vary depending on the type of license, location, and profession.

Who May Need a License Bond?

License bonds are commonly required for contractors and other businesses operating in regulated industries. The bond may be necessary when applying for a license, renewing an existing license, or meeting specific contractual or regulatory requirements.

Contractors may encounter different bonding requirements depending on their trade and the jurisdiction where they perform work.

How Do License Bonds Work?

When a surety company issues a license bond, it guarantees the bonded business will meet the obligations outlined by the applicable licensing authority. If a valid claim is made and the surety pays the claimant, the bonded business may be responsible for reimbursing the surety according to the terms of the bond agreement.

Because requirements differ by situation, selecting the correct bond amount and type is important.
